Actions Involved in Cat Flap Installation

While the process may differ slightly depending upon the type of door or wall you're installing the flap in, the general steps normally include:

StepDescription1. EvaluationThe expert assesses the door or wall to determine the very best location for the flap.2. MeasurementAccurate measurements are taken to guarantee the flap is the right size for your cat.3. ChoicePick the suitable cat flap based on pet size, energy effectiveness, and design.4. CuttingThe installer cuts an opening in the door or wall for the flap, making sure precision.5. InstallationThe flap is installed, and necessary seals are contributed to prevent drafts or leaks.6. CheckingThe installer tests the flap to ensure it opens and closes correctly and that there's no blockage.7. Clean-upExperts tidy up the workspace, guaranteeing no particles or tools are left behind.8. GuidelineThe expert provides guidelines and suggestions for your cat to use the flap successfully.

Kinds Of Cat Flaps

Not all cat flaps are created equivalent; owners can choose from various designs and features. Here are some common types:

Type of Cat FlapFeaturesHandbook FlapEasy flaps that swing both ways, typically without any locking mechanism.Magnetic FlapUses magnets to keep the flap closed when not in use while permitting easy gain access to for cats wearing a magnetic collar.Microchip FlapScans your cat's microchip to only enable recognized animals to enter or leave.Electronic FlapActivated by a remote control or app, this choice provides innovative security and ease of access functions.High-Security FlapEnhanced locking systems for included security against intruders and the components.
